How do you calculate a percentage?
To calculate a percentage, you typically convert the percentage to a decimal (by dividing it by 100) and then multiply it by the total amount. For example, 25% of 200 is calculated as (25 / 100) * 200 = 50.
What is the formula for percentage change?
The formula for percentage change is: ((Final Value – Initial Value) / Initial Value) * 100. A positive result indicates an increase, while a negative result indicates a decrease. Our calculator does this for you automatically.
